What is a Project Scope Statement?

A project scope statement is a document that defines the project’s scope, objectives, deliverables, and timelines. It is a critical tool for any project manager, as it helps to ensure that all stakeholders are on the same page and that the project is completed successfully.

A project scope statement should be clear and concise, and it should be written in a way that is easy to understand for all stakeholders. It should also be updated regularly as the project progresses.

How to Write a Project Scope Statement

There are many different ways to write a project scope statement. However, the following steps will help you to create a clear and concise document:

  1. Define the project’s scope.
  2. Identify the project’s objectives. The objectives of the project are the specific goals that you want to achieve. These objectives should be spec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ound.
  3. Determine the project’s deliverables. The deliverables of the project are the products or services that will be produced as part of the project. These deliverables should be clearly defined and agreed upon by all stakeholders.
  4. Set the project’s timelines. The timelines of the project are the dates when the project is scheduled to start and finish. These timelines should be realistic and achievable.

    There are many benefits to using a project scope statement. These benefits include:

    • Improved communication: A project scope statement helps to improve communication between all stakeholders. It ensures that everyone is on the same page and that there are no misunderstandings about the project’s scope, objectives, deliverables, or timelines.
    • Reduced risk: A project scope statement can help to reduce risk by identifying potential problems and risks early on. This allows the project manager to take steps to mitigate these risks and prevent them from impacting the project.
    • Increased efficiency: A project scope statement can help to increase efficiency by providing a clear roadmap for the project. This roadmap helps to keep the project on track and prevents wasted time and resources.
